Pittsburgh will be facing Dallas tonight and the only Star on the ice in 2019-20 has been Sidney Crosby. The Stars a 1-6-1 on the year with no standout players. Tyler Seguin and Alexander Radulov only have four points each while Jamie Benn has the same amount of points as Jamie Oleksiak, two. Roope Hintz has been one of the few bright spots with four goals and five points in the eight games, but none of which have come in the last three games.

Speaking of Jamie Oleksiak he will be returning to Pittsburgh for the first time since his time with the Penguins. The Oleksiak situation was a weird one. He was fine as a Penguin and there was no pressing need to move him. His presence should have been enough for the team to avoid pursuing Jack Johnson, but his lower cap hit and better on-ice play wasn’t enough to sway the decision makers. It’s only 29 game sample since leaving, but I imagine it is a better 29 game stretch than anything his replacement has done.

I would make the argument that Oleksiak being one-punched was definitely part of the decision to move on from him. The “Tom Wilson broke the Penguins” meme has some truth to it. Pittsburgh became infatuated with being as tough as or tougher than the Capitals and as a result abandoned why they consistently beat them in the past. The team then went on to replace Oleksiak with a more expensive and less effective version in Gudbranson. The string of moves lacked planning and made the team worse and more expensive.
